Cast Member (Christmas Temp)
Job Summary:
Join the limited-time Disney Store destination at Westfield White City. The pop-up gives fans and families the chance to explore the stories they love and shop a wide range of Disney products in a magical retail setting.
We have a number of temporary positions available which require flexible availability across the entirety of the Christmas Season. The tentative end date for these fixed-term agreements are January 3rd or January 10th. The required hours will be 12 or 16 hours per week.
About the Role & Team
The Cast Member engages Guests in magical experiences throughout the Store, delighting them with stories, while providing options of quality, innovative product that meets their needs. They will provide an exceptional Service that will exceed the Guest’s expectations by focusing on the show that they experience to ensure that it is unique and memorable. Maintaining integrity of the brand, whilst adhering to your own grooming guidelines.
What You Will Do
Show Sales
- Takes a proactive role in maintaining Disney brand standards.
- Maintains a neat and organised Store, on stage and back stage so that product is clearly represented and available for replenishment.
- Maintains and participates in producing company visual standards to present an outstanding Store environment.
- Ensures that all new product is on stage so that the Guest experiences the most current assortment.
- Assists with stock deliveries and replenishment to agreed standards.
- Participates in markdowns, event set-up and Stage Sets.
- Achieves financial and efficiency goals, as agreed with the management team, through appropriate actions and use of Guest service behaviours.
- Sets priorities and handles time effectively and efficiently.
- Welcomes every guest with a smile and makes eye contact with them, accompanying them through the sales process.
- Performs effective till transactions that enhance the Guest perception and observes all relevant SOPs protecting Company assets including cash handling
Service Contribution
- Promotes Guest loyalty by demonstrating detailed product knowledge and providing outstanding guest service.
- Provides friendly, accurate and efficient service.
- Listens and asks questions to identify and meet Guests’ needs.
- Engages Guests at their level allowing them to become a part of the story.
- Adapts to changing needs of Guests while maintaining a high level of service.
- Learns quickly when facing new obstacles. Uses information to find solutions for Guests and challenges.
- Uses creativity, language, store tools and product to bring stories to life.
- Performs scripted and non-scripted events for Guests in both one-on-one and group settings.
- Follows all safety guidelines.
- Demonstrates awareness of and compliance to Company Policies (including Loss Prevention and Health and Safety Procedures) and local employment laws.
- Ensures integrity of the brand by maintaining Disney Store standards of grooming guidelines and behaviour.
- Participates in Company sponsored events that integrate the Disney brand into the local community (Volunt’EARs)
- Supports initiatives that give back and have a positive impact on the internal and the external community.
- Processes delivery in a fast and accurate manner following all guidelines and achieving process goals.
- Ensures accuracy when completing Stock Inventory Counts and tasks.
- Additional responsibilities and duties will be assigned based on the needs of the business
Required Qualifications & Skills
- Passion for interacting with Guests of all ages.
- Attention to detail and ability to prioritise Guests and tasks.
- Retail/service experience in sales preferred but training will be given.
- Flexibility to work different day/shifts as needed based on availability given
- Ability to assist with store events which maybe scripted or non scripted
- Ability to understand store commercial targets and daily expectations i.e. talk ups, go with, basket fill.
- Housekeeping to ensure both on stage and back stage the areas are clean and tidy.
- Time management and organisational skills.
- Success in working in a team environment.
- Good communication skills being able to adjust communication to the guest.
- Professional appearance.
- Ability to learn about the product and the franchise.
- Visual merchandising experience (albeit training will be given)
- Cash handling and till work/card transitions (albeit training will be given)
- Discount eligibility checks and integrity
The Perks
- Free Park Entry: You will have the opportunity to enter any of our parks with your family and friends for free
- Disney Discounts: you are entitled to discounts on designated Disney products
